📊 Kelly Criterion for Bitcoin Trading: How Much Capital Should You Allocate?

Many traders focus on when to buy or sell Bitcoin, but an equally important question is:
How much of my available capital should I allocate to a trade?
One mathematical framework that can help answer this is the Kelly Criterion.
It uses two key inputs from your historical trading performance:
🔹 W = Winning probability
🔹 R = Average profit ÷ Average loss
The basic formula is:
Kelly % = W − [(1 − W) ÷ R]
🧮 Simple Bitcoin Example
Suppose you analyze 100 previous BTC trades:
✅ 60 trades were profitable
❌ 40 trades were unprofitable
Therefore:
W = 60 ÷ 100 = 0.60
Now suppose your average profitable trade was $300, while your average unprofitable trade was $200.
So:
R = 300 ÷ 200 = 1.5
Now apply the formula:
Kelly % = 0.60 − [(1 − 0.60) ÷ 1.5]
= 0.60 − 0.2667
= 0.3333
So:
📌 Kelly Allocation = 33.33%
If your available trading capital is $10,000:
$10,000 × 33.33% = $3,333
The mathematical model therefore suggests an allocation of approximately $3,333 under these assumptions.
🔍 Why Both W and R Matter
A high winning percentage doesn’t automatically mean a strong allocation.
For example:
W = 70%
R = 0.5
Kelly:
70% − (30% ÷ 0.5) = 10%
But another system could have:
W = 50%
R = 2
Kelly:
50% − (50% ÷ 2) = 25%
So a system winning only 50% of its trades can mathematically produce a higher allocation when its average profitable outcome is significantly larger than its average negative outcome.
⚠️ One Important Point
Kelly depends heavily on the quality of your historical data.
If your estimated winning probability or profit/loss relationship changes, the calculated allocation changes too.
For that reason, traders may use Half Kelly or Quarter Kelly instead of the full calculated value.
For example, if:
Full Kelly = 40%
Then:
Half Kelly = 20%
Quarter Kelly = 10%
This provides a more conservative interpretation of the mathematical result.
🧠 The Complete Process
For Bitcoin trading, think of it as:
Historical BTC trades → W + R → Kelly % → Capital allocation → BTC quantity
The formula itself is simple:
Kelly % = W − [(1 − W) ÷ R]
But the quality of the answer depends on having a sufficiently large and representative trading history.
📌 Key takeaway:
Don’t look only at how often your BTC strategy is profitable. Also measure how large your average positive and negative outcomes are. The relationship between these two factors is what makes the Kelly calculation useful for mathematical capital allocation.

2. Crypto Lesson 📚

One of the biggest mistakes beginners make:

They focus too much on the entry price.

A good entry matters, but risk management matters more.

Imagine entering a trade at the “perfect” price but risking 30–40% of your account on one position.

One wrong move can erase weeks of progress.

Instead, think like this:

Protect capital first. Grow it second.

You don’t need to win every trade.

You just need to make sure one losing trade doesn’t take you out of the game. 🎯

Have you noticed how most retail traders treat leverage like a lottery ticket instead of a risk management tool?

Watching an open position bleed into the red while refusing to cut losses is the single fastest way to blow up your account. Most traders freeze when a trade turns against them, hoping for a miraculous bounce rather than executing an invalidation level.

Take a look at the recent liquidations on volatile mid-caps like $BTR . Holding an open long deep underwater down -29.50% with an unrealized loss exceeding -10,646 USDT is not diamond hands, it is pure liquidation gambling. When volatility spikes across pairs like $BTC and higher-beta altcoins like $SOL , market makers will ruthlessly hunt those overleveraged positions.

If you want to survive these market conditions, you need a rule-based execution plan. First, determine your maximum acceptable loss before entering any futures order, not after the drawdown begins. Second, hardcode a stop-loss that caps risk at 1-2% of total equity so a single bad trade cannot wipe out weeks of gains. Finally, size down significantly when trading low-liquidity perps because slippage will crush you on the exit.
